Weather Stream’s GEMS2-Amethyst Satellite Achieves First Light, Delivering Global Atmospheric Data from Orbit

Next-generation commercial microwave radiometer begins returning temperature, humidity, and precipitation observations from space

Weather Stream Inc. today announced that its GEMS2-Amethyst satellite has achieved first light, collecting global atmospheric observations from orbit. Launched March 30 aboard SpaceX's Transporter 16 rideshare mission from Vandenberg Space Force Base, GEMS2-Amethyst is the latest iteration of the company's Global Environmental Monitoring System (GEMS) meteorological satellite mission.

GEMS2-Amethyst carries a dual-band passive microwave radiometer designed and built in-house by Weather Stream’s Boulder, Colorado team. The instrument measures three-dimensional atmospheric temperature and humidity profiles across a nearly 2,000-kilometer swath, providing near global coverage approximately every 12 hours. Integrated with a satellite bus from Denmark-based GomSpace, the satellite reached a sun-synchronous orbit at nearly 600 kilometers with a projected operational life of 3-5 years. Payload calibration activities are now underway ahead of data validation and delivery.
